Expansion Joint Foam – Non Adhesive (Ableflex Concrete Joint Filler)

All rolls are 10mm thick and 25 metres long

Expansion joint foam (Ableflex) is a high-quality closed-cell polyethylene foam that prevents cracking in concrete by allowing movement between slabs.

Concreters, builders and landscapers use this non-adhesive joint filler to create a compressible barrier that absorbs expansion and contraction caused by temperature changes, load movement and ground settling.


🧱 What It’s Used For

Install this foam between concrete sections to form a flexible joint. As a result, it helps prevent cracking and structural damage over time.

Common applications include:

  • Driveways and footpaths
  • Concrete slabs
  • Kerbing and channel work
  • Tilt-up and precast panels
  • Around walls, columns and pipes
  • Brickwork and blockwork joints
